Introduction: The Urgent Mandate of METAvivor
In the landscape of oncology, metastatic breast cancer (MBC)—cancer that has spread beyond the breast to bones, liver, lungs, or brain—remains the most critical challenge. Despite the proliferation of awareness campaigns, the vast majority of research funding historically targets early-stage prevention rather than the treatment of stage IV disease. At the center of this struggle is METAvivor, a non-profit organization uniquely dedicated to the specific funding of metastasis research.
In a recent communication, Dr. Kelly Shanahan, President of METAvivor and a physician living with MBC, outlined the current state of the field. Her report details a period of intense activity, marked by a surge in research interest, high-stakes international conferences, and a shifting regulatory environment. As the organization navigates a doubling of grant applications amidst federal funding uncertainty, the focus remains clear: elevating the patient voice to redefine how clinical success is measured.
Main Facts: A Surge in Research Interest and Advocacy
The spring and summer of the current year have proven to be a pivotal juncture for METAvivor. The organization’s Scientific Advisory Board (SAB) recently convened to review 200 Letters of Intent (LOIs) for the current grant cycle. This figure represents a 100% increase over traditional application volumes for the second consecutive year.
According to Dr. Stuart Martin, a long-standing member of the SAB, this influx is not merely a sign of increased scientific interest but a reflection of a broader "challenging time for research." As federal dollars become more precarious and competitive, private organizations like METAvivor are filling a critical vacuum, ensuring that high-impact metastasis research does not stall.
The organization’s leadership is also taking a prominent role on the global stage. Dr. Shanahan has been invited to present at the American Society of Clinical Oncology (ASCO) Annual Meeting in Chicago, as well as the Hormel Institute’s Global Cancer Consortium in Minnesota. These appearances signal a growing recognition within the medical community that patient advocates—particularly those who are also medical professionals—are essential stakeholders in the design of clinical trials.
Chronology of Events: From Grant Reviews to Global Stages
Late May: The Grant Review Process
The cycle began with the SAB meeting to filter the 200 LOIs. The next phase involves inviting the most promising researchers to submit full applications. These proposals will undergo a rigorous double-review process involving both scientific experts and Patient Advocate Reviewers (PARs). This dual-layered approach ensures that funded projects are not only scientifically sound but also relevant to the lived experiences and priorities of the MBC community.
May 31: ASCO and the Call for Meaningful Endpoints
At the ASCO conference in Chicago, one of the world’s largest gatherings of oncology professionals, Dr. Shanahan is scheduled to address a session titled "Elevating the Patient Voice: Choosing the Right Patient-Centered Endpoints in Modern Clinical Trials."
Her presentation focuses on a critical flaw in traditional oncology research: the disconnect between what researchers measure and what patients value. While clinical trials often focus on "Progression-Free Survival" (PFS) or "Overall Survival" (OS), Dr. Shanahan argues for a more nuanced approach that includes quality-of-life metrics and endpoints that reflect the daily reality of living with a chronic, terminal illness.
Mid-June: The Hormel Institute Global Cancer Consortium
Following ASCO, the focus shifts to Minnesota for the Hormel Institute’s symposium. Here, the emphasis will be on the "hallmarks of metastasis." Dr. Danny Welch, a pioneer in the field and an original METAvivor grant recipient, will deliver the keynote. The meeting serves as a technical deep-dive into the biological mechanisms that allow cancer cells to migrate and colonize distant organs, a process that remains the primary cause of breast cancer mortality.
Supporting Data: The Science of New Therapeutics
The field of MBC treatment is currently experiencing a rapid influx of new therapeutic options, particularly for Estrogen Receptor-positive (ER+), HER2-negative (HER2-) subtypes.
The ESR1 Mutation Challenge
A significant portion of current research focuses on the ESR1 mutation, which often develops as a resistance mechanism to aromatase inhibitors (AIs). Data from the SERENA-6 trial has been a focal point of recent discussion. The trial investigated the use of camizestrant, a next-generation oral selective estrogen receptor degrader (SERD), in combination with CDK4/6 inhibitors.
Recent FDA Approvals
The FDA has been active in the second quarter of the year, granting several key approvals:
- Vepdegestrant (Veppanu): A new targeted therapy for ER+/HER2- MBC patients harboring the ESR1 mutation.
- Datopotamab Deruxtecan (Datroway/Dato-DXd): Approved as a first-line treatment for patients with metastatic Triple-Negative Breast Cancer (TNBC) who are ineligible for immunotherapy. This represents a significant advancement for one of the most aggressive forms of the disease.
- Trastuzumab Deruxtecan (Enhertu/TDXd): While already a staple in metastatic care, the FDA expanded its indications into the early-stage HER2+ setting, aiming to reduce the risk of recurrence and the subsequent development of metastatic disease.
Official Responses: Regulatory Divergence and the "Patient Voice"
A major point of contention in the oncology community involves the recent vote by the FDA’s Oncologic Drugs Advisory Committee (ODAC) regarding camizestrant. The committee voted against recommending the approval of switching to camizestrant upon the detection of an ESR1 mutation before radiographic evidence of progression.
The ODAC’s cautious stance contrasts sharply with the European Medicines Agency (EMA) Committee for Medicinal Products for Human Use, which recommended approval based on the same SERENA-6 data. This divergence highlights a fundamental debate in modern oncology: Should treatment be altered based on circulating tumor DNA (ctDNA) and molecular markers, or should clinicians wait for traditional imaging (CT/PET scans) to show physical tumor growth?
METAvivor leadership, including board members Janice Cowden and Lynda Weatherby, has been vocal in this debate. Through the "Live from Stage 4" podcast, they have advocated for the incorporation of new technology into regulatory decisions. The FDA has since announced it is continuing to review the data, leaving the door open for a potential reversal or a more specific indication for the drug.
Implications: Redefining the "Bigger Table"
The surge in grant applications and the prominence of patient advocates at conferences like ASCO suggest a paradigm shift in the oncology world. The implications of this shift are three-fold:
1. The Democratization of Research Funding
The doubling of grant LOIs indicates that the scientific community is increasingly looking toward specialized non-profits to sustain innovation. As federal funding becomes more volatile, the role of community-funded research becomes a pillar of the scientific ecosystem. However, this places a significant burden on fundraising efforts, as the demand for research dollars currently outstrips available resources.
2. The Integration of "Patient-Centered Endpoints"
Dr. Shanahan’s advocacy for trial endpoints that "ask us what we want" is more than a rhetorical flourish. It is a call for a structural change in how the FDA and pharmaceutical companies design studies. If a drug extends life by three months but results in a total loss of functional independence, is it a "success"? By centering the patient voice, the industry is being pushed to value "Time Without Symptoms or Toxicity" (TWiST) alongside traditional survival metrics.
3. The Personalization of Metastatic Care
The approvals of Dato-DXd and vepdegestrant, alongside the debate over ESR1 mutations, underscore the move toward highly personalized medicine. The "one size fits all" approach to breast cancer is being replaced by molecularly driven strategies. For the patient, this means more options, but it also requires a higher level of health literacy and access to advanced diagnostic testing, such as liquid biopsies.
